Research Overview & Focus
The researcher's research focuses on advancing sustainable agricultural practices, particularly through intercropping systems and land management strategies. They emphasize improving plant and soil health, integrating agroforestry methods, addressing environmental factors such as heavy metals, and exploring sustainable resource use by farmers. The work combines empirical evidence with theoretical models to address challenges in optimizing agricultural sustainability across diverse ecosystems.
